La programación autodidacta se está convirtiendo en una tendencia cada vez más popular entre los programadores. Esta forma de aprendizaje se ha convertido en una forma más accesible para los aspirantes a programadores, que ahora pueden aprender por su cuenta sin necesidad de seguir un curso tradicional. En este artículo, examinaremos los beneficios de la programación autodidacta, así como los pasos necesarios para comenzar a programar por su cuenta.
¿Qué es la programación autodidacta?
Contenidos
La programación autodidacta es una forma de aprender a programar por su cuenta. Esto significa que los programadores aprenden sin un maestro o tutor tradicional. Esto se hace a través de recursos como tutoriales en línea, videos, libros y foros. Esta forma de aprendizaje es cada vez más popular entre los programadores, ya que les permite aprender a su propio ritmo y en su propio entorno.
Ventajas de la programación autodidacta
La programación autodidacta ofrece numerosas ventajas para los programadores. Estas incluyen:
- Mayor flexibilidad: Al aprender por su cuenta, los programadores tienen la flexibilidad de trabajar en su propio horario y a su propio ritmo. Esto significa que no hay presión para cumplir con los plazos establecidos por un maestro o tutor.
- Mayor control: Al aprender por su cuenta, los programadores tienen el control sobre el tema que están estudiando. Esto les permite centrarse en las áreas en las que tienen un interés especial.
- Mayor libertad: Al aprender por su cuenta, los programadores tienen la libertad de probar y experimentar con sus habilidades. Esto les permite ver qué funciona y qué no, sin el temor de ser juzgados por un maestro o tutor.
Cómo comenzar a programar autodidactamente
Comenzar a programar autodidactamente puede ser un desafío, pero con la información correcta, los programadores pueden comenzar a programar por su cuenta. Estos son algunos pasos útiles para comenzar a programar autodidactamente:
1. Elige un lenguaje de programación
El primer paso para comenzar a programar autodidactamente es elegir un lenguaje de programación. Esto es importante ya que el lenguaje de programación que elija determinará qué tipo de proyectos puede crear. Hay muchos lenguajes de programación diferentes para elegir, como Java, Python, C++ y JavaScript. Es importante que elija un lenguaje que se ajuste a sus necesidades y que tenga una buena documentación.
2. Encuentra recursos de aprendizaje
Una vez que haya elegido un lenguaje de programación, es importante encontrar recursos de aprendizaje adecuados. Esto puede incluir tutoriales en línea, libros, videos y foros. Estos recursos le ayudarán a aprender los conceptos básicos de programación, así como a desarrollar sus habilidades.
3. Comienza con un proyecto simple
Una vez que haya aprendido los conceptos básicos de programación, es importante comenzar con un proyecto simple. Esto le ayudará a poner en práctica lo que ha aprendido y a desarrollar sus habilidades. Algunos proyectos simples incluyen la creación de una calculadora, un juego simple o una aplicación web.
4. Comparte tu trabajo
Una vez que haya terminado un proyecto, es importante compartirlo con la comunidad de programadores. Esto le ayudará a obtener retroalimentación y consejos de otros programadores. Esto también le ayudará a desarrollar sus habilidades y a construir una red de contactos profesionales.
Conclusiones
La programación autodidacta se está convirtiendo en una tendencia cada vez más popular entre los programadores. Esta forma de aprendizaje ofrece muchas ventajas, como mayor flexibilidad, control y libertad. Los programadores pueden comenzar a programar autodidactamente siguiendo los pasos descritos anteriormente. Si bien el aprendizaje autodidacta puede ser un desafío, es una excelente manera de desarrollar sus habilidades de programación y de construir una red de contactos profesionales.